在列表渲染的数据
key值不宜用index 一般使用后台传入数据的id
key值增加代码可读性
可以用template进行包裹,并且不会被渲染到页面上 <template v-for="(item,index) in list" :key="item.id"> <div > 序号:{{index}}----- </div> <span>{{item.content}}</span> </template> -->
改变数组内容:
Vue.set(app.数组, 下标, 改变的值)
Vue数组的操作
push:增加一条 pop:删除数组最后一项 shift:删除数组第一项 unshift:想数组第一项加内容 splice:做数组的截取 splice(下标号,删除几条,{往里增加一条 }) sort:数组的排序 reverse:数组取反 set:改变任意
<!--在console里面 添加一个数组 方法一:直接对对象重新赋值 app.list={ name:‘123‘, id:‘4‘, content:‘hhhhhh‘ } 方法二:这个是键值对 Vue.set(app.list, ‘id‘,‘111‘) -->
原文:https://www.cnblogs.com/yubaibai/p/10701258.html